A friend found this at a estate sale and knowing my interest sent it to me.

these uniforms belonged to Hugie L Foote jr who gradusted from the US Naval Academy in 1933 as a Supply corps officer. The photo shows him wearing the Academy uniform. The other uniforms are his Lt Jr Grade and Lt Commanders Uniform. The coin he got when he crossed the equator in 1936 aboard the USS Arizona. And the records are of his military assignments. I thought the members of this site would be interested in seeing this group. The uniforms have a few moth holes but all togather not to bad. post-476-1174958095.jpg
